Nerea, New York

Nerea is a stylish Mediterranean restaurant where West Village charm, coastal Italian flavors, and polished dining come together in a way that feels both refined and effortlessly social.

On Greenwich Avenue between West 12th and Jane, right in the heart of the West Village and surrounded by tree-lined streets and brownstones, this upscale Italian-leaning restaurant brings a fresh, seafood-forward energy to one of downtown's most beloved neighborhoods. Nerea builds its identity around Mediterranean-inspired Italian cuisine, with a strong emphasis on seafood and seasonal ingredients.

The menu leans into crudos, pastas, and lighter entrΓ©es that highlight freshness and balance. There's a noticeable focus on presentation and ingredient quality, giving each dish a refined edge. The space itself mirrors that philosophy, elegant but approachable, designed to feel modern while still grounded in the neighborhood. Its West Village location draws a mix of locals and destination diners looking for something elevated but not overly formal.
